History and Growth:
On-line poker surfaced within the late 1990s due to developments in technology while the internet. The first internet poker room, earth Poker, premiered in 1998, attracting a little but passionate neighborhood. However, it was in the first 2000s that internet poker practiced exponential growth, primarily as a result of the introduction of real-money games and televised poker tournaments.

Popularity and Accessibility:
One of the most significant cause of the enormous interest in internet poker is its accessibility. People can log in to their most favorite internet poker platforms anytime, from anywhere, utilizing their computers or mobile phones. This convenience has actually attracted a diverse player base, ranging from leisure players to specialists, adding to the rapid development of internet Highstakes poker.

Features of Internet Poker:
Online poker provides several advantages over standard brick-and-mortar casinos. Firstly, it offers a larger variety of online game choices, including numerous poker variations and stakes, providing to your choices and spending plans of forms of people. Additionally, internet poker rooms tend to be open 24/7, getting rid of the limitations of physical casino operating hours. Additionally, internet based platforms frequently offer appealing incentives, commitment programs, while the capacity to play numerous tables simultaneously, improving the entire video gaming experience.
